Publisher's summary

Her son has brain cancer, but she has never been happier.

Instead of going to war, she chose to redefine her narratives about cancer and forgive it in order to win the fight and heal the soul.

The author’s and her family’s life turned upside down when they found out about her son’s diagnosis. The pandemic COVID-19 broke out at the same time when Max was undergoing brain surgeries. After Max’s three brain surgeries, doctors announced that his hands would be permanently disabled; instead of giving up, Max was trying to move his arms every day. Today, Max can draw with both his left hand and right. This champion is ready to soar high, and only the sky is the limit.

This is an inspiring story about the most challenging mindset shift the author of the book has ever had to make in order to win this fight, letting cancer heal her life. It is not about struggling with it, suffering from it, breaking under the burden of it. It is about dealing with it and forgiving it.

Despite her son’s brain cancer diagnosis and surgeries had turned her and her family’s life upside down, the book's author managed to maintain an aura of happiness, peace, and grace.

She didn’t allow herself to be blindsided by fear, so she decided to go to the other side of that terror, standing on firm ground. Shirley turned negative emotions into forces of energy that empowered her to become as spiritually supportive as possible and keep a positive attitude.

Life is a journey; it ebbs and flows. Cancer contains opportunities for transformation and actions to expand higher and brighter and communicate with our spirit and soul about how to live our lives. The author is deeply convinced that it is possible to awaken soul beyond cancer and forgive cancer.
